Nginx 集群 反向代理多个服务器

时间:2021-6-4 作者:qvyue

准备多个服务器,使用 nginx 先做好代理(我这里只有一台服务器,就拷贝两个 tomcat了,端口分别设置为 8081 和 8082)

1,复制 tomcat

cp -r apache-tomcat-8.0.83 jd1
cp -r apache-tomcat-8.0.83 jd2

2,修改端口,要修改 3 个地方

vim jd1/conf/server.xml
Nginx 集群 反向代理多个服务器
Nginx 集群 反向代理多个服务器
Nginx 集群 反向代理多个服务器
vim jd2/conf/server.xml
Nginx 集群 反向代理多个服务器
Nginx 集群 反向代理多个服务器
Nginx 集群 反向代理多个服务器

3,修改 tomcat 默认首页,这样才能知道 nginx 访问了哪个tomcat(如果是集群,就知道是访问了哪台服务器)

4,配置虚拟主机(当访问nginx 的时候会跳转到 tomcat 的 8081 或 8082 端口)

Nginx 集群 反向代理多个服务器

5,重启 nginx ,测试(每次刷新页面,内容会发生变化,就算成功了)

Nginx 集群 反向代理多个服务器
Nginx 集群 反向代理多个服务器
声明:本文内容由互联网用户自发贡献自行上传,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任。如果您发现有涉嫌版权的内容,欢迎发送邮件至:qvyue@qq.com 进行举报,并提供相关证据,工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。